## Ownership

The clock-skew monitor for the Quarrylight build farm lives in this repo. Build agents occasionally drift more than the 250ms tolerance, which breaks artifact timestamp ordering and causes the Slatebird scheduler to mark runs as flaky. If support sees skew alerts, first check the NTP sidecar logs, then escalate rather than restarting agents manually — restarts mask the drift without fixing it. Questions about the monitor, its thresholds, or the escalation path go to the component owner listed below.

account owner for kagag-yahap: Novath Quenok

# Approvals: Markdown Rendering Pipeline

All changes to the Quillstone rendering pipeline — sanitizer rules, extension plugins, or the HTML allowlist — require written approval before merge. As a contractor, open a change request, attach rendered before/after samples, and wait for explicit sign-off; silence is not approval. Final approval authority for this pipeline is held by the person below.

approver of bagug-bagag = Holael Pramir

Fan-out backpressure for the Quillet notifier: when the queue depth crosses the soft limit, the dispatcher sheds low-priority pushes and batches the rest at 500ms intervals. Reviewer should confirm the shed counter is exported and that retries respect the jitter window. Once merged, the release artifact gets re-signed by the pipeline, which expects the deploy key shown below.

deploy key for bawep-yawif: bky6_GQhaSt